Man arrested for killing young boy who broke his tablet
By Coconuts Bangkok

takrob.chaiya.suratthani.jpg

BANGKOK: -- The adopted son of a Surat Thani-province politician has been accused of murdering a young boy for breaking his new toy.

Police arrested the 19-year-old man on Sunday on suspicion of murdering a 4-year-old boy but did not release his name to the public.

The boy had been missing since his parents took him to a teacher retirement dinner at a local primary school.

His body was later found about 100 meters away in a pond, and a forensic examination concluded he'd died of organ failure and internal bleeding from blunt-force trauma, Bangkok Post reported.
